Domningia sodhae Thewissen and Bajpai 2009
Diagnosis
ReferenceDiagnosis
J. G. M. Thewissen and S. Bajpai 2009Diagnosis.—Dugongine with upper incisors which are greatly
flattened medio−laterally, and multi−rooted upper premolars,
unlike most dugongines. Domningia differs from Corysto−
siren and Rytiodus in having incisors that are more or less flat
(not oval) on cross−section and in having a long nasal process
of the premaxilla. In Domningia, the exoccipitals meet in the
median plane dorsal to the foramen magnum, unlike Dioplo−
therium and Bharatisiren.
